In Backpacking 101, you will learn about what gear to take backpacking, how to plan a trip, and the resources to help you get started. Backpacking 101 is an introductory-level program that covers the basics of hike-in camping or point to point.
This program will begin by talking about the differences in types of camping trips, then give information on how to plan a hike-in camping, or backpacking, trip. We’ll also talk about what gear you need to take and discuss the differences between different equipment such as down vs synthetic sleeping bags. We won’t be backpacking during this program, but there will be an opportunity to wear a full backpack and a few different types of packs.
